fre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

圖書館管理系統(tǒng)的設(shè)計與實現(xiàn)畢業(yè)設(shè)計(編輯修改稿)

2025-05-04 23:05 本頁面
 

【文章內(nèi)容簡介】 系統(tǒng)的登錄密碼,這些操作都是建立在管理員信息表上進行的。 數(shù)據(jù)庫概念設(shè)計對數(shù)據(jù)庫進行設(shè)計可以有很多種方法,比如傳統(tǒng)的瀑布模型、原型模型、螺旋模型等,單數(shù)人們目前最常使用也最常見的就是ER模型(實體聯(lián)系模型),它是采用畫圖的方式來描述客觀的現(xiàn)實世界[[]郭寧,馬玉春,[M](第2版).北京:.]。通過上面對系統(tǒng)鳳需求分析和系統(tǒng)設(shè)計,我設(shè)計的數(shù)據(jù)庫實體分別為管理員、學生、老師、圖書、圖書借閱和圖書類別等實體。在下面我就采用了ER圖的方式進行簡要介紹。 管理員 編號用戶名密碼圖310 管理員實體ER圖 圖書類別信息描述名稱編號是否刪除 圖311 圖書類別實體ER圖借閱信息 編號 圖書編號 讀者類型讀者編號借閱時間到期時間歸還時間是否刪除圖312 借閱信息實體ER圖 圖書信息圖書編號圖書名稱圖書作者出版社出版日期圖書書號頁碼… 圖313 圖書信息實體ER圖 系統(tǒng)各個模塊設(shè)計本系統(tǒng)登陸時可以以學生、老師和管理有三種身份登錄,通過輸入用戶名、密碼并選擇登陸身份登陸系統(tǒng),其中管理員屬于后臺管理,學生和老師是前臺管理,以登陸身份的不同分為以下三個模塊。學生:(1)個人信息管理:學生可以查看個人的基本信息; (2)圖書列表管理:學生可以查看圖書的信息列表,查看目前的圖書 情況,以便借閱; (3)圖書借閱管理:學生可以查看自己的借閱情況,學生借閱圖書的 時間是10天,登陸成功后可以查看借閱的書籍、到期時間、歸還時間以及是否歸還等信息。 (4)瀏覽圖書館基本信息:瀏覽圖書館簡介、機構(gòu)設(shè)置、規(guī)章制度、 館藏分布、版權(quán)公告和擴展資源。老師:(1)個人信息管理:老師可以查看個人的基本信息; (2)圖書列表管理:老師可以查看圖書的信息列表,查看目前的圖書 情況,以便借閱; (3)圖書借閱管理:老師可以查看自己的借閱情況,老師借閱圖書的 時間是15天,登陸成功后老師可以查看借閱的書籍、到期時間、歸還時間以及是否歸還等信息。 (4)瀏覽圖書館基本信息:瀏覽圖書館簡介、機構(gòu)設(shè)置、規(guī)章制度、 館藏分布、版權(quán)公告和擴展資源。管理員:(1)系統(tǒng)管理:管理員可以對自己的基本信息進行查看,可以修改 自己的登陸密碼,同時添加和刪除管理員信息。 (2)圖書管理:管理員可以對圖書的信息進行管理,管理員可以查 看、添加、刪除圖書的基本信。 (3)圖書類別管理:管理員可以對圖書的類別進行管理,管理員可以添加圖書的類別和并進行相應(yīng)的描述,查看刪除圖書的類別信息。 (4)讀者管理:管理員可以對老師和學生的信息進行審核,可以查看教師和學生的審核情況,包括審核通過的和審核沒通過的,同時管理員可以查看、刪除老師和學生的基本信息。 (5)借閱管理:管理員可以對學生和老師的借閱信息進行管理,管 理員可以查看、添加、刪除老師和學生的借閱信息,包括借閱時間、到期時間以及是否歸還等信息,同時管理員可以對老師和學生借閱圖書進行歸還。 (6)瀏覽圖書館基本信息:瀏覽圖書館簡介、機構(gòu)設(shè)置、規(guī)章制度、 館藏分布、版權(quán)公告和擴展資源。 詳細設(shè)計 數(shù)據(jù)庫表結(jié)構(gòu)設(shè)計為了更好的實現(xiàn)本課題的基本功能和達到最初設(shè)計的目的,我主要設(shè)計了6張數(shù)據(jù)表,分別為:學生信息表(t_user)、管理員信息表(t_admin)、圖書借閱信息表(t_jieyue)、圖書信息表(t_book)、教師信息表(t_tea)和圖書類別信息管理表(t_catelog),下面我對幾個關(guān)鍵表進行闡述[[] 明日科技,盧翰,[M](第2版)北京:.]:(1) t_user(學生信息表)學生信息表主要用來保存學生的基本信息,基本的表結(jié)構(gòu)如表31所示: 表31學生信息表(t_user)字段名數(shù)據(jù)類型字段描述長度主鍵idint自動編號11√loginnamevarchar登錄用戶名50loginpwvarchar登錄密碼50xuehaovarchar學生學號50xingmingvarchar學生姓名50xueyuanvarchar學院50zhuanyevarchar專業(yè)50telvarchar電話50varchar電子郵件50zhuangtaivarchar審核狀態(tài)50delvarchar是否刪除50(2) t_admin(管理員信息表)管理員信息表主要用來保存管理員的基本信息,基本的表結(jié)構(gòu)所表32示:表32管理員信息表(t_admin)字段名數(shù)據(jù)類型字段描述長度主鍵userIdInt自動編號11√userNamevarchar登錄用戶名50userPwvarchar登陸密碼50(3)t_jieyue(圖書借閱信息表)圖書借閱信息表主要用來存放圖書借閱的信息,基本的表結(jié)構(gòu)如表33所示: 表33圖書借閱信息表(t_jieyue)字段名數(shù)據(jù)類型字段描述長度主鍵idint自動編號11√bookIdint圖書編號11duzheleixingvarchar讀者類型50duzheIdint讀者編號11jieyueShijianvarchar借閱時間50daoqiShijianvarchar到期時間50guihuanshijianvarchar歸還時間50delvarchar是否刪除50(4)t_catelog(圖書類別信息表)圖書類別信息表主要用于保存圖書類別的信息,具體的表結(jié)構(gòu)如表34所示:表34圖書類別信息表(t_catelog)字段名數(shù)據(jù)類型 字段描述長度主鍵catelog_idint類別編號11√catelog_namevarchar 類別名稱50catelog_miaoshutext描述信息100catelog_delvarchar 是否刪除50 數(shù)據(jù)庫表間關(guān)系設(shè)計圖314 數(shù)據(jù)庫表間關(guān)系圖通過圖311我們可以看出各個表之間的關(guān)系,通過借閱表中的外鍵圖書編號(bookId)可以與圖書表建立聯(lián)系,圖書表中的外鍵圖書類別編號(catelog_id)可以與圖書類別信息表建立聯(lián)系,同理通過借閱信息表的讀者編號(duzheId)可以與教師表和學生表建立聯(lián)系。 4 系統(tǒng)實現(xiàn) 登陸模塊 用戶登錄對本圖書館管理系統(tǒng)進行設(shè)計和開發(fā)后,如果用戶需要使用該系統(tǒng),首先進入到的就是登陸界面,如果之前沒有進行過注冊,則第一次登陸該系統(tǒng)時需要進行注冊,點擊注冊填寫注冊清單,等待管理員審核,當管理員審核通過之后就可以登錄并使用該系統(tǒng)了,如果是之前已經(jīng)注冊過,則只需要錄入用戶名、密碼并選擇身份就可以登錄系統(tǒng)了,提交后的數(shù)據(jù)會在后臺作相應(yīng)處理,將提交的用戶名和密碼與數(shù)據(jù)庫中的數(shù)據(jù)取出來分別放在兩個字符串中,然后將兩個字符串進行比較匹配,如果兩者的值相同則根據(jù)權(quán)限登錄到相應(yīng)的界面,如果不匹配則登錄失敗。圖41登陸模塊界面關(guān)鍵代碼:function callback(data)//將用戶輸入的數(shù)據(jù)與數(shù)據(jù)庫中的數(shù)據(jù)進行對比 {(indicator).=none。//取得頁面里的ID為indicator的控件設(shè)置為隱藏if(data==no)//如果不匹配則顯示“用戶名或者密碼錯誤”{alert(用戶名或密碼錯誤)。}if(data==yes)//輸入的數(shù)據(jù)與數(shù)據(jù)庫匹配則顯示“通過驗證,系統(tǒng)登錄成功” { alert(通過驗證,系統(tǒng)登錄成功)。=%=path%/。//跳轉(zhuǎn)界面} 用戶簡介模塊實現(xiàn) 用戶注冊當用戶第一次使用本系統(tǒng)時,必須進行注冊,注冊時可以以學生或者老師兩種身份進行注冊,注冊成功后等待管理員審核,當管理員審核通過后就可以使用本系統(tǒng)了。 Action和User Action中相應(yīng)的reg_tea和reg_User的注冊方法將注冊的數(shù)據(jù)保存到數(shù)據(jù)庫中。圖42學生注冊關(guān)鍵代碼: public String reg_user() //調(diào)用方法reg_user { TUser user=new TUser()。 //設(shè)置學生的基本信息 (loginname)。 (loginpw)。 (xuehao)。 (xingming)。 (xueyuan)。 (zhuanye)。 (tel)。 ()。 (a)。 //狀態(tài)為a (no)。 //沒有被刪除(user)。 //保存信息 return successAdd。 } 圖43老師注冊關(guān)鍵代碼:public String reg_tea() //調(diào)用方法reg_tea()并設(shè)置老師的基本信息 { TTea tea=new TTea()。 (loginname)。 (loginpw)。 (bianhao)。 (xingming)。 (sex)。 (age)。 (a)。 (no)。 (tea)。 return successAdd。 } 用戶個人信息管理用戶登錄系統(tǒng)成功后可以查看自己的基本信息, Action和User
點擊復制文檔內(nèi)容
公司管理相關(guān)推薦
文庫吧 www.dybbs8.com
備案圖片鄂ICP備17016276號-1